What Defines A Snuff Film

  • The classic snuff-film definition is footage of people murdered specifically to create a commercial film.
  • No verified example of that commercial, purpose-made snuff film has ever surfaced.

Cultural Roots Of The Snuff Panic

  • Snuff rumors emerged in the 1970s amid rising visibility of hardcore porn and vivid war imagery.
  • Cultural exposure to televised violence and pornography helped seed belief in organized snuff networks.

How A Movie Was Marketed As Snuff

  • Producer Alan Shackleton retitled and reworked an exploitation film into Snuff by adding a staged final sequence.
  • The marketing played on snuff rumors and used protests to boost interest at release.
